Covenants and Blockbusting – How Developers Leveraged Racism to Change Cities and Make Millions

This is a good historical background on Baltimore, and how first restrictive Jim Crow era covenants, and later – racial blockbusting was used by developers not only to make millions – but to manipulate homeowners. This is how American cities developed segregated neighborhoods.
